To deliver major infrastructure projects, we are looking for a Project Director to join us. Working on a variety of different projects, you’ll contribute to planning, bidding, overseeing and completing the projects that are part of COWI’s portfolio.

Responsibilities

  • Planning and operating assigned projects within your portfolio, including risk management, interface management, resource management
  • Key account and project client management
  • Contract review and negotiation
  • Preparing bids, including fee proposals, technical responses, programmes, tender designs, risk screenings and bid submission notes
  • Completing projects in compliance with the COWI Quality Management System and utilising the Operational Excellence Project Management tools
  • Achieving project financial, schedule, quality and client satisfaction goals
  • Ensuring appropriate technical oversight/review is provided to the project team
  • Project closure activities, including preparation of design cost statistics, updating of team member resumes and preparation of content for project reference sheets
  • Contributing to regular month-end closure activities including project estimates, resolving project overruns
  • Long-term planning sheets and resource planning
  • Growing the business with clients, including taking advantage of cross-selling opportunities
